Your restaurant is collecting more data than you think. Are you actually using it?
Every restaurant generates a significant amount of data during a single service. Reservations tell you who is coming, your POS records what guests order and spend, and kitchen systems capture what is being prepared and how the service progresses.
Before the first guest arrives, you may already know how many covers to expect, which guests have allergies or dietary requirements, where larger parties are seated and when the busiest part of the evening is likely to begin. Once service starts, another layer of information is added.
Orders arrive, courses move through the kitchen, tables progress at different speeds and preparation times change throughout the evening. By the end of the night, all of those individual moments form a detailed picture of how the service actually went.
Yet much of that information is still used only in the moment, stored across different systems or simply forgotten once the last table leaves.
The question is no longer whether restaurants have enough data. It is whether they are turning that data into something useful.
Before service: use what you already know.
A well prepared service starts long before the first order reaches the kitchen. Reservation data, for example, can provide both front of house and kitchen teams with useful context about the evening ahead.
Imagine an upcoming service with 85 covers, several larger parties, returning guests and six different dietary requirements. Having that information available allows the team to prepare accordingly. However, its value quickly decreases when it remains inside the reservation system.
An allergy that still needs to be copied, written down or verbally communicated to the kitchen creates another manual step. The same applies to guest preferences, special occasions and other information that could influence the service.
When systems can exchange relevant information, preparation becomes less dependent on someone remembering to check and communicate every detail.
Useful information before service could include:
- Expected covers and arrival times
- Allergies and dietary requirements
- Returning guests and relevant preferences
- Large parties or special arrangements
- Expected peak moments during the service
The objective isn't to give teams more information to process. It is to make sure the information they need is available where they need it.
During service: the plan meets reality.
Every restaurant starts the evening with a plan, but service rarely follows that plan exactly. Guests arrive early or late, one table wants to slow down while another is ready for the next course, and several large orders can reach the kitchen within minutes of each other.
At that point, real time operational information becomes much more valuable than the original plan.
Front of house needs to understand what is happening in the kitchen, while the kitchen benefits from knowing what is happening in the restaurant. Without that visibility, teams often fall back on verbal updates.
How long for table 12?
Can we send the next course?
Is the main course ready?
One question isn't a problem. Dozens of those questions during a busy service create interruptions, additional communication and more opportunities for information to be missed.
When teams share the same operational information, they can make decisions without constantly asking each other for updates. At the same time, the restaurant starts building a much clearer record of what actually happened during service.
That includes information such as preparation times, time between courses, delays and periods where particular parts of the operation were under pressure.
Revenue tells you the result, not the whole story.
After service, revenue is understandably one of the first numbers restaurants look at. It tells you something important about the commercial result of the evening, but very little about how that result was achieved.
Consider two Saturday evenings with similar covers and exactly the same revenue.
During the first service, courses move smoothly, the kitchen stays in control and front of house has time to focus on guests. During the second, the kitchen spends most of the evening catching up, servers repeatedly ask for updates and several tables wait longer than intended.
Financially, those evenings may look almost identical.
Operationally, they are completely different.
This is where preparation times, course timings and other service data provide additional context. They allow restaurants to look beyond the final sales figure and understand how efficiently the operation performed.
Revenue shows what you achieved. Operational data can help explain how you achieved it.
Patterns are more valuable than individual moments.
A slow dish on one evening doesn't necessarily require action. Neither does one table waiting longer than expected. Hospitality involves people, and every service is different.
Repeated patterns are much more useful.
You might discover that a particular course consistently takes longer during peak hours. Perhaps delays start appearing once the restaurant reaches a certain number of covers. One kitchen station may become a bottleneck when several specific dishes are ordered at the same time.
Or the issue may not be in the kitchen at all. Front of house might regularly spend time requesting information that already exists somewhere else in the operation.
Looking at operational data over time can help answer questions such as:
- At what point during service do delays usually begin?
- Which courses or dishes regularly require more preparation time?
- Are certain stations more affected during peak periods?
- How much time typically passes between courses?
- Which information does front of house repeatedly need from the kitchen?
- Are there differences between quieter services and fully booked evenings?
Individual moments tell you what happened once. Patterns help you understand how your operation behaves.
Connect the information instead of collecting more.
Making better use of data doesn't necessarily mean collecting more of it. For many restaurants, the information already exists.
The challenge is that it lives in different places.
The reservation system knows who is coming and may already contain relevant guest information. The POS knows what has been ordered. The kitchen knows what is being prepared and how far each table has progressed. Front of house knows what is happening at the table.
When these systems operate independently, people often become the connection between them. Information is checked, repeated, entered again or communicated verbally.
Integrations can remove part of that dependency.
This doesn't mean every restaurant needs one large platform that handles every process. Specialised systems can continue doing what they do best, while exchanging the information that other parts of the operation need.
